How Common Is The Last Name Brusky? popularity and diffusion
The last name Brusky is the 442,270th most commonly occurring family name internationally, held by approximately 1 in 9,427,614 people. The last name Brusky is predominantly found in The Americas, where 94 percent of Brusky are found; 86 percent are found in North America and 86 percent are found in Anglo-North America.
The surname Brusky is most widely held in The United States, where it is carried by 633 people, or 1 in 572,605. In The United States Brusky is most common in: Wisconsin, where 54 percent reside, Illinois, where 13 percent reside and Florida, where 5 percent reside. Besides The United States Brusky is found in 9 countries. It is also found in Brazil, where 8 percent reside and Canada, where 5 percent reside.
Brusky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Brusky has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the last name grew 2,752 percent between 1880 and 2014.
